File tree Expand file tree Collapse file tree 1 file changed +51
-38
lines changed Expand file tree Collapse file tree 1 file changed +51
-38
lines changed Original file line number Diff line number Diff line change 11dist : trusty
22sudo : required
33
4- language : node_js
5- node_js :
6- - lts/*
7-
8- services :
9- - docker
10-
11- addons :
12- apt :
13- packages :
14- - docker-ce
15-
16- script :
17- - if [ "true" = "${SHELLCHECK-}" ]; then shellcheck *.sh ; fi
18- - if [ -n "${NODE_VERSION-}" ]; then ./test-build.sh $NODE_VERSION ; fi
19- - if [ "true" = "${DOCTOCCHECK-}" ]; then
20- npm i -g doctoc &&
21- cp README.md README.md.tmp &&
22- doctoc --title='## Table of Contents' --github README.md &&
23- diff -q README.md README.md.tmp;
24- fi
25-
26- env :
27- - DOCTOCCHECK : true
28- - NODE_VERSION : ' 4'
29- - NODE_VERSION : ' 6'
30- - NODE_VERSION : ' 8'
31- - NODE_VERSION : ' 9'
32- - NODE_VERSION : ' chakracore/8'
33-
34- matrix :
4+ language : generic
5+
6+ script : ./test-build.sh $NODE_VERSION
7+
8+ jobs :
359 include :
36- env : SHELLCHECK=true
37- addons :
38- apt :
39- sources :
40- - debian-sid
41- packages :
42- - shellcheck
10+ - stage : Test
11+ env :
12+ - TEST : Doc Toc Check
13+ language : node_js
14+ install : npm i -g doctoc
15+ script :
16+ - cp README.md README.md.tmp &&
17+ doctoc --title='## Table of Contents' --github README.md &&
18+ diff -q README.md README.md.tmp
19+
20+ - stage : Test
21+ env :
22+ - TEST : Shell Check
23+ script : shellcheck *.sh
24+ addons :
25+ apt :
26+ sources :
27+ - debian-sid
28+ packages :
29+ - shellcheck
30+
31+ - stage : Build
32+ services :
33+ - docker
34+ addons :
35+ apt :
36+ packages :
37+ - docker-ce
38+ env :
39+ - NODE_VERSION : ' 4'
40+
41+ - stage : Build
42+ env :
43+ - NODE_VERSION : ' 6'
44+
45+ - stage : Build
46+ env :
47+ - NODE_VERSION : ' 8'
48+
49+ - stage : Build
50+ env :
51+ - NODE_VERSION : ' 9'
52+
53+ - stage : Build
54+ env :
55+ - NODE_VERSION : ' chakracore/8'
You can’t perform that action at this time.
0 commit comments